Web7 apr. 2024 · A systematic review is defined as “a review of the evidence on a clearly formulated question that uses systematic and explicit methods to identify, select and critically appraise relevant primary research, and to extract and analyze data from the studies that are included in the review.”. The methods used must be reproducible and …

WebClinical Evaluation Report with incomplete documentation of the literature search and review will lead to a non-conformity. Because the MDCG document 2024-13 specifically requires notified bodies to verify the literature search documentation, this can result in unnecessary questions or even audit variations. WebScoping reviews are exploratory, and they typically address a broad question. Researchers conduct them to assess the extent of the available evidence, to organise it into groups and to highlight gaps. Sometimes scoping reviews are also used to decide whether or not it would be useful to conduct a systematic review .
